Applications, where only one side is accessible, require "blind" rivets. Solid rivets are driven using a hydraulically, pneumatically, or electromagnetically actuated squeezing tool or even a handheld hammer. The setting of these fasteners requires access to both sides of a structure. Steel rivets can be found in static structures such as bridges, cranes, and building frames. "Ice box" aluminium alloy rivets harden with age, and must likewise be annealed and then kept at sub-freezing temperatures (hence the name "ice box") to slow the age-hardening process. Some aluminium alloy rivets are too hard to buck and must be softened by solution treating ( precipitation hardening) prior to being bucked. Typical materials for aircraft rivets are aluminium alloys (2017, 2024, 2117, 7050, 5056, 55000, V-65), titanium, and nickel-based alloys (e.g., Monel). Such rivets come with rounded (universal) or 100° countersunk heads. Hundreds of thousands of solid rivets are used to assemble the frame of a modern aircraft. A typical application for solid rivets can be found within the structural parts of aircraft. Solid rivets are used in applications where reliability and safety count.
